Output df3d59cd0860b0b9583c547d507a702ea42fd8c8e50d8d7d9485bdf81e3580b8:1

value
43727700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61ad6420d2308b22aba5fd2143f124d947a318b1 OP_EQUAL
address
3AbVBaUQzkRUshTxCyFAfn6rTNXFuXVwFr
transaction
df3d59cd0860b0b9583c547d507a702ea42fd8c8e50d8d7d9485bdf81e3580b8
confirmations
476423
spent
true